Genuine Ideal Boiler CH Return Valve Pack 175923
Compatibility :
- Atlantic Combi: 24, 30, 35
- Classic 2 Combi: 24, 30, 35
- Combi: 24, 30
- Esprit Eco: 24, 30
- Exclusive 2 Combi: 24, 30, 35
- Exclusive Combi: 24, 30, 35
- Ideal i: 24, 30, 35
- I Combi 2: 24, 30, 35
- I Mini: 24, 30, C24, C30
- +C: C24, C30, C35
- Independent: C24, C30, C35
- Independent Combi: 24, 30, 35
- Instinct Combi: 24, 30, 35
- System: 15, 18, 24, 30
- System IE: 15, 18, 24, 30
- System S: 15, 18, 24, 30
- Logic System: 15, 18, 24, 30
- Logic + System: 15, 18, 24, 30
- Logic + System S: S15, S18, S24, S30
- Logic System S IE: S15IE, S18IE, S24IE, S30IE
- MAX System S: 15, 18, 24, 30
- Ultra System: 15, 18, 24, 30
- Ultra + System: 15, 18, 24, 30
- Keston System: 30, S30
- Procombi Exclusive: 24, 30, 35
- Morco / LPG: GB24, GB30

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What is an Ideal CH return valve pack?
An Ideal CH return valve pack is a genuine boiler component that controls the flow of water returning from the heating system back into the boiler. It helps maintain proper circulation, ensures efficient heating performance, and protects internal components from irregular flow or pressure issues.
2. What does the return valve do?

3. What are the common faults with ideal boilers?
Some of the commonest problems include the ignition not working, a leak in the boiler or heating system, a pump failure, a problem with the internal electrics or an expansion vessel failure.
4. What are the benefits of using a return valve?
Backflow prevention: Stops contaminated water from re-entering your clean supply.
Equipment protection: Prevents pressure damage in pumps and heaters.
Improved efficiency: Maintains steady flow direction through your plumbing system.
5. Should return valves be fully open?
Flow and return valves Fully open, with handles lined up neatly with the pipes. This keeps hot water flowing out to your radiators and returning for reheating. Closing these will shut down your central heating circuit.
